Additional File 2:
Input data file for poisson_kriging.exe. This dataset follows the Geo-EAS format and includes, for 295 counties of New England, the following information: FIPS code, spatial coordinates of the county geographic centroid, age-adjusted cancer mortality rate per 100,000 person-years, and the population at risk for the 1970–1994 period.
